Output 4377c93e2d6323808fdcdb7cea8458a49ef017f49c34c9e1ad91171c87edf811:3

value
2630158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7df8ccb7b9f485833aa9fba28abc1d14fc26108f OP_EQUAL
address
3DB6SRjbz9WSPRYdouaCeZyziTH42DrYet
transaction
4377c93e2d6323808fdcdb7cea8458a49ef017f49c34c9e1ad91171c87edf811
spent
true